Output 31a8f53a1121c81b7b6245896b26291eb424f93027f321da6338159aed325513:1

value
2321684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9c3fe98e4328bb023af49afca384b0ec8226816f21c40a9b9cbd362d4e4a71fe
address
bc1pnsl7nrjr9zasywh5nt728p9sajpzdqt0y8zq4xuuh5mz6nj2w8lqtnpd8y
transaction
31a8f53a1121c81b7b6245896b26291eb424f93027f321da6338159aed325513
confirmations
52383
spent
true